Movie “Joy” finding happiness in life despite everyday obstacles

Award-winning director David O. Russell's latest movie "Joy" is about a woman finding happiness in life despite everyday obstacles.

But the word might also be used to sum up Russell's relationship with Jennifer Lawrence, the actress he calls his muse, who has starred in his last three movies.

Russell, who directed Lawrence in her 2012 Oscar-winning role as a young widow in "Silver Linings Playbook" and in 2014's "American Hustle," said that as an actress and a person, she inspires him to take risks with filmmaking.
